Rank Star Wars movies least to greatest. (Due to both of our RPs having SW references this round)

I like movie references, but to be honest I'm not a huge SW fan. I blame this mostly on a shitty stepdad who would watch it ad nauseum. That said, I've watched every Star Wars movie and I'd be more than happy to share my list.


  • The Star Wars Christmas Special - We know why.
  • The Clone Wars - This was a movie.
  • Attack of the Clones - Anakin's dialogue/acting was lame. Yoda was cool though.
  • The Phantom Menace - Jar Jar. I liked Qui Gon Jinn and the podrace. Missed potential with Sebulba as a reoccurring villain I think.
  • Return of the Jedi - Everything was okay but I hated the teddy bears.
  • Revenge of the Sith - Excellent musical score at least.
  • A New Hope - Good spaghetti westernesque flick. Luke's as whiny as his dad.
  • The Force Awakens - Pretty much the same thing as New Hope but the main protagonist isn't as whiny.
  • Empire Strikes Back - First movie I ever watched where the bad guys win in the end. Lando, Boba Fett, and the Emperor were pretty cool. Not much I hate about this movie.

Worst : Phantom Menace- Keep the pod race, erase everything else. Just a major let down top to bottom. So pissed when I first watched it. Jar Jar Binks.

Attack of the Clones - Exciting last twenty minutes couldn't save the long boring, awkward love story going on with the cheesiest shit lines in all of Sci-Fi.

Revenge of the Sith - A lot of action compared to the last outing. Fantastic final moments and set ups for the original trilogy.

Force Awakens - It was good, but nothing mind blowing about it. Borrowed heavily off of New Hope, a little TOO heavily. Finding the Falcon and the following chase was my favorite part.

A New Hope - The one that started it all, I must have watched it 50 times as a kid, pure love for the movie.

The Return of the Jedi - Watching it now is nothing special, as a kid it blew my mind. I came out of the theatre gobsmacked, especially after - It's a trap!- and the entire legion of fighters clashing in space and the triple climax ending. It will always hold a special place in my heart for that crazy space battle.

The Empire Strikes Back -

I hated Empire the first time I watched it as a kid. I didn't like that the bad guys won and hated the idea of it. Then I watched it again, and again, and again. It's one of the best Sci-Fi movies ever made. The whole chase between The Empire and The Falcon throughout the middle of the film only to use Han Solo to draw in Luke Skywalker is brilliant. The scene at the dinner table and Han shoots a laser at Vader and he casually blocks it and takes his blaster away, the Imperial March churning with every Empire sighting, the Hoth battle and Luke vs Vader.
